Understanding the Tulsa Climate Impact
Tulsa’s climate is classified as humid subtropical, which places unique stress on HVAC systems. According to historical data, Tulsa experiences average high temperatures exceeding 90°F (32°C) in summer and can drop below freezing in winter. This dual demand means your equipment works harder than in milder climates.
Local experts understand:
- Humidity Control: High humidity in Tulsa requires AC units that effectively dehumidify, not just cool.
- Hard Water Issues: Tulsa’s water supply can be hard, leading to mineral buildup in plumbing and water heaters.
- Storm Preparedness: Severe thunderstorms and occasional tornadoes can damage external HVAC units. Local pros know how to secure and repair storm-damaged systems quickly.

The Importance of Regular Maintenance
Preventative maintenance is the most cost-effective way to manage your home systems. Ignoring maintenance can lead to efficiency drops of up to 5% per year, according to the U.S. Department of Energy.
Benefits of Annual Tune-Ups
- Extended Lifespan: Regular care can add years to your AC and furnace life.
- Lower Energy Bills: Clean filters and coils run more efficiently.
- Fewer Breakdowns: Small issues are caught before they become expensive emergencies.

Step-by-Step: What to Do During an HVAC Emergency
If your system fails in the middle of a Tulsa heatwave or freeze, follow these steps while waiting for your Custom A C Heating Cooling & Plumbing Tulsa Ok technician.
- Check the Thermostat: Ensure it is set to the correct mode (Cool/Heat) and temperature. Replace batteries if needed.
- Inspect the Circuit Breaker: Look for tripped breakers in your electrical panel. Reset them if necessary.
- Change the Air Filter: A clogged filter can restrict airflow and cause the system to shut down.
- Clear Debris: If it’s an AC issue, check the outdoor unit for leaves or debris blocking the fan.
- Call a Professional: If these steps don’t resolve the issue, contact your trusted local provider immediately. Avoid attempting complex repairs yourself, as this can void warranties and pose safety risks.

1. How often should I service my AC and Heating systems in Tulsa?
It is recommended to service your AC in the spring (before summer hits) and your heating system in the fall (before winter). Bi-annual maintenance ensures optimal performance during peak seasons.
2. What is the average lifespan of an HVAC system in Oklahoma?
Due to the heavy usage required by Tulsa’s climate, most AC units last 10–15 years, while furnaces can last 15–20 years with proper maintenance.

4. How do I know if I need to repair or replace my unit?
Consider replacement if your unit is over 10 years old, requires frequent repairs, or if your energy bills are steadily increasing. A good rule of thumb is the “$5,000 Rule”: Multiply the age of your equipment by the repair cost. If the result is more than $5,000, consider replacement.
5. Why is my plumbing making banging noises?
This is known as “water hammer.” It occurs when water flow is suddenly stopped, causing a shockwave in the pipes. It can damage joints and fixtures. A professional plumber can install air chambers or water hammer arrestors to fix this.
